Western Grebes During Courtship


 


I photographed this couple last May just before they began their mating dance.

Western Grebes are known for their ballet-like courtship display. Male and female grebes run across the water in unison, their long necks curved in an elegant S-shape. It’s a mesmerizing sight!

I read that Grebes also perform dancing with weeds when they hold bits of weed in their bills and "dance" on the water. Unfortunately, I have never seen this dance.
